Adoption could be said to be an answer to prayer for many people, especially those who find it hard to have their own children. Many people in this world are unable to have children of their own for health reasons. This situation is always disappointing for couples who desperately want children. To some people, starting and raising a family is the most important goal in their lives. There hopes and is dreams are quickly taken away when a doctor informs them that having children naturally is not possible.

Adopting a child is the only option for couples who are unable to reproduce. Adoption also provides hope and joy to thousands of couples. It gives them an opportunity to become parents and raise children in a family environment. Adopting a child also offer these couples a privilege which in the real world would have been impossible. Adoption makes the dream of some couples come true, by making them have the family they have always wish to have. Some couples adopt one child leading to adopting one or more further down the road.

Adoption is not meant for only couples who can not produce there own children. There are couples who are quite capable of producing their own offspring but rather they decide to adopt instead. The reason why thy do this, is to help them plan there lives, big families with six or seven children are almost unheard of. Most families today consist of two parents with two or three children. In most cases where both parents are working and the option of the mother staying home to raise children is out the only option they have is adoption in order to survive financially and provide for the family. If a couple chooses to have only one child, perhaps they might choose adoption. The process of adoption not only provides the adoptive parents with hope but also provides hope for a child who desperately needs love and attention. There are thousands, perhaps even millions of children in the world who are seeking loving homes and caring parents. They are lucky when there are couples who recognize this need and choose adoption rather than having children of their own Millions of people in the world, makes it their mission to provide at least one child a chance of happiness through adoption.

Some families are made of two parents and children yet they choose to adopt, especially when they are fortunate enough financially to support a third or even forth child. Seeing other children in need stirs feelings of compassion, this does not happen to parents alone but also children Often times some families decides to adopt a child who is less-fortunate and needs a loving family. These families when they have made up there mind to adopt do not mind whether the adoption if from a neighboring town or a foreign country, these families are determined and committed to providing a stable, loving home-life for an adopted child.

In adoption couples show an act of love and compassion to the less privileged. For many people choosing adoption means their only chance at ever having children while for others choosing adoption is an act of selflessness and compassion. There are many reasons people choose adoption and although personal, they are motivated by love. For the child being adopted, adoption is their key to a bright and happy future.

Many of us consider the opportunity to go to school and learn, or to have clean water and fresh food on your table something very normal, we can’t imagine life without these simple things. But in many poor countries these things are considered a luxury. The children that are born in these countries have a dark future ahead of them, they won’t be able to use a computer or to read a book, their only opportunity is to work as hard as they can, but their work will be hard labor.

Children in the poor countries have to work at very young ages. They usually begin working at around six or eight years, and because they don’t have experience they start as beggars. Then they polish shoes and sell small things. At 13 years they start working more seriously, and at 15 hard labor begins.
